<comment type="function">
<text>Receptor for prostacyclin (prostaglandin I2 or PGI2). The activity of this receptor is mediated by G(s) proteins which activate adenylate cyclase.</text>
</comment>
<comment type="subcellular location">
<subcellularLocation>
<location>Cell membrane</location>
<topology>Multi-pass membrane protein</topology>
</subcellularLocation>
</comment>
<comment type="PTM">
<text>Palmitoylation of either Cys-308 or Cys-311 is sufficient to maintain functional coupling to G(s) and signaling.</text>
</comment>
<comment type="PTM">
<text>Isoprenylation does not influence ligand binding but is required for efficient coupling to the effectors adenylyl cyclase and phospholipase C.</text>
</comment>
<comment type="similarity">
<text>Belongs to the G-protein coupled receptor 1 family.</text>
